They and seven locals are believed to be working for a fake investment syndicate in China.

Police detained 79 Chinese nationals and seven locals believed to be working for a fake investment syndicate in China at two bungalows along Jalan Logan in George Town, Penang, on Tuesday.

"During the raids, there were 77 men and nine women at the three-storey bungalows situated side by side, and they were all on their computers in the living room of the buildings,” Che Zaimani said yesterday.
